Changed defaults in Splitfork, our assignment service. Bucketing now uses sticky hashing per account instead of per session, and the holdout slice grew from 2% to 5%. Callers relying on session-level reassignment must opt in explicitly. Review the diff against the new baseline; the updated default configuration is listed below.

config for tagep-kajof:
[casir]
port = 6379
region = south-1
host = casir.paliqdyn.example
team = tamax
timeout_ms = 250
retries = 2

**Deploy step 4: Breaker config for upstream Fetchline API**

Ship the Tollgate circuit-breaker config with the 2.3 release. Thresholds: trip at 50% error rate over 30s, half-open probe every 10s, max 3 probes. Do not deploy to prod until staging shows two clean trip/recover cycles. Bundle the config with the service manifest and push through the standard pipeline. The manifest must be signed or the rollout controller rejects it. Sign with the deploy key below.

deploy key for kajof-fajop: bky6_gDHw9Q

## Runbook: Digestly batch scheduler release

Before approving, verify the cron matrix changes against the tenant digest windows and confirm no overlap with the quiet-hours table. Tag the build, run the scheduler dry-run, and diff the emitted send plan. The artifact must be signed prior to promotion; verify the signature against the key below.

rollout seal: bky4_x7Gc